forgot to hook up ECT - throw lambda code too? 900

ok so I'm a bonehead, and I forgot to hook up the engine coolant temp sensor under the #3 intake rail after replacing the head, gasket, etc. It was very hard to start at first, but ran well after. It threw fault codes for ect (#2, 123) and lambda too lean/rich at idle (#6, 224). Is it possible bothwere due to my bonehead move? How do I find out if it was too lean or too rich? I cleared the codes, but have to go to work, wifey will be driving today and we will see if it throws another CEL. Any comments are appreciated.
